What Is Platelet-Rich Plasma (PRP) Therapy?

In simple terms, PRP therapy uses a concentrated dose of your own blood platelets to stimulate healing and rejuvenation in targeted areas. It’s been a rising star in orthopedics and dermatology, and now it’s making remarkable strides in reproductive medicine.

The rationale? PRP is packed with growth factors that may enhance the uterine lining and improve ovarian function — two vital elements for conception.

What is Platelet-Rich Plasma (PRP) Therapy?

PRP therapy involves drawing a small amount of your blood, spinning it in a centrifuge to concentrate the platelets, and then injecting this rich plasma into specific areas to stimulate healing and regeneration. In fertility treatments, this method aims to rejuvenate ovarian function and improve the uterine lining, two critical factors in successful conception.

According to the recent INVO Fertility announcement, patients now have access to this promising therapy at a leading institute, opening new doors for those facing unexplained infertility or diminished ovarian reserve.
